首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在android中删除浮点数的尾数(java)

在Android中删除浮点数的尾数可以使用Java语言提供的Math类中的round()函数进行四舍五入操作。具体步骤如下:

  1. 首先,将浮点数传入round()函数中。例如,要删除尾数的浮点数为float或double类型的变量num。
  2. 调用Math类的round()函数,传入浮点数作为参数。该函数会返回一个最接近原始浮点数的整数。
  3. 将返回的整数转换回浮点数类型,可以使用floatValue()或doubleValue()方法。

下面是示例代码:

代码语言:txt
复制
float num = 3.14159f; // 原始浮点数
int roundedNum = Math.round(num); // 四舍五入操作
float result = (float) roundedNum; // 转换回浮点数类型

// 输出结果
System.out.println("原始浮点数: " + num);
System.out.println("删除尾数后的浮点数: " + result);

应用场景: 在开发Android应用中,如果需要对浮点数进行精确计算或者展示时,可能需要删除尾数。例如,当处理金融数据或进行几何计算时,删除浮点数的尾数可以提高计算精度。

推荐腾讯云相关产品:

  1. 云服务器(Elastic Compute Cloud,简称 CVM):提供高性能、可扩展的计算能力,支持多种操作系统和应用。 产品链接:https://cloud.tencent.com/product/cvm
  2. 云数据库 MySQL 版(TencentDB for MySQL):提供高性能、可扩展的关系型数据库服务,适用于各种规模的应用程序。 产品链接:https://cloud.tencent.com/product/cdb_mysql

请注意,以上推荐的产品仅为示例,并非实际的答案要求。请根据实际情况选择适合的产品。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

11分1秒

day11_项目二与面向对象(中)/18-尚硅谷-Java语言基础-项目二:CustomerView删除客户功能的实现

11分1秒

day11_项目二与面向对象(中)/18-尚硅谷-Java语言基础-项目二:CustomerView删除客户功能的实现

11分1秒

day11_项目二与面向对象(中)/18-尚硅谷-Java语言基础-项目二:CustomerView删除客户功能的实现

7分30秒

day17_项目三/20-尚硅谷-Java语言基础-项目三TeamView中删除开发团队成员

6分19秒

44.尚硅谷_硅谷商城[新]_在适配器中删除选中的item.avi

7分5秒

MySQL数据闪回工具reverse_sql

4分36秒

04、mysql系列之查询窗口的使用

14分0秒

day24_集合/08-尚硅谷-Java语言高级-Map中存储的key-value的特点

13分19秒

day07_数组/19-尚硅谷-Java语言基础-数组中的常见异常

10分50秒

day13_面向对象(中)/13-尚硅谷-Java语言基础-equals()的使用

10分51秒

day13_面向对象(中)/18-尚硅谷-Java语言基础-toString()的使用

12分6秒

day20_常用类/21-尚硅谷-Java语言高级-StringBuffer中的常用方法

领券